Donald Mcclymont Sells 46,928 Shares of indie Semiconductor (NASDAQ:INDI) Stock

indie Semiconductor, Inc. (NASDAQ:INDIGet Free Report) CEO Donald Mcclymont sold 46,928 shares of indie Semiconductor stock in a transaction that occurred on Monday, August 31st. The stock was sold at an average price of $3.72, for a total value of $174,572.16. Following the transaction, the chief executive officer owned 468,441 shares of the company’s stock, valued at $1,742,600.52. This represents a 9.11% decrease in their ownership of the stock. The sale was disclosed in a legal filing with the Securities & Exchange Commission, which is available at this link.

indie Semiconductor (NASDAQ:INDIGet Free Report) last released its quarterly earnings results on Thursday, August 6th. The company reported ($0.05) ear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, hitting the consensus estimate of ($0.05). The company had revenue of $64.01 million for the quarter, compared to analysts’ expectations of $62.49 million. indie Semiconductor had a negative net margin of 65.18% and a negative return on equity of 32.02%. The firm’s revenue for the quarter was up 24.0% compared to the same quarter last year. During the same period last year, the company earned ($0.08) EPS. As a group, equities research analysts anticipate that indie Semiconductor, Inc. will post -0.53 EPS for the current fiscal year.

About indie Semiconductor

(Get Free Report)

indie Semiconductor, Inc is a fabless semiconductor company headquartered in San Jose, California, that specializes in advanced chip solutions for the automotive industry. The company designs and develops microcontrollers, sensor processing units, application processors and power management integrated circuits tailored for electric vehicles (EVs), advanced driver assistance systems (ADAS), infotainment and digital clusters. indie’s product portfolio aims to deliver high performance, energy efficiency and functional safety to meet stringent automotive requirements.
